Transaction 68bd3de56c05057cf3592ac9866125697bb7c728da0afdf82ef42d817e91578d
1 Input
1 Output
-
68bd3de56c05057cf3592ac9866125697bb7c728da0afdf82ef42d817e91578d:0
- value
- 14405
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ae33949db18e9e509f992c9ba0d204c6b0c3051f
- address
- bc1q4ceef8d33609p8ue9jd6p5syc6cvxpgl2cj89a